Output e6b4dad7f8de3ab532f1c51eeda09d46d126bc074d294a3767c5e0de32f1fd2e:152

value
385811
script pubkey
OP_0 OP_PUSHBYTES_20 659b23de79fde357fbfbaf56b7ef6097f46be56c
address
bc1qvkdj8hnelh3407lm4att0mmqjl6xhetvps4w0y
transaction
e6b4dad7f8de3ab532f1c51eeda09d46d126bc074d294a3767c5e0de32f1fd2e
confirmations
164586
spent
true